Transaction 208378b495cbf8eb8b6d8606c66b65e32b24e4d728385169c5911de750112f8b

1 Input
2 Outputs
  • 208378b495cbf8eb8b6d8606c66b65e32b24e4d728385169c5911de750112f8b:0
  • value  475743992
    address  31zDdGwwdT67Lu584bf8n8BHDbdmrsAsPT
  • 208378b495cbf8eb8b6d8606c66b65e32b24e4d728385169c5911de750112f8b:1
  • value  24240888
    address  1ECBeppmvEELrE2e3U18y3dR7DXSt8n172